Improving microservice-based applications with runtime placement adaptation
Abstract Microservices are a popular method to design scalable cloud-based applications. Microservice-based applications (μApps) rely on message passing for communication and to decouple each microservice, allowing the logic in each service to scale independently. Complex μApps can contain hundreds...
Main Authors: | Adalberto R. Sampaio, Julia Rubin, Ivan Beschastnikh, Nelson S. Rosa |
---|---|
Format: | Article |
Language: | English |
Published: |
Brazilian Computing Society (SBC)
2019-02-01
|
Series: | Journal of Internet Services and Applications |
Subjects: | |
Online Access: | http://link.springer.com/article/10.1186/s13174-019-0104-0 |
Similar Items
-
Visualizing Anti-Patterns in Microservices at Runtime: A Systematic Mapping Study
by: Garrett Parker, et al.
Published: (2023-01-01) -
Estimating runtime of a job in Hadoop MapReduce
by: Narges Peyravi, et al.
Published: (2020-07-01) -
Evolution of Microservices Identification in Monolith Decomposition: A Systematic Review
by: Idris Oumoussa, et al.
Published: (2024-01-01) -
Decentralized Stream Runtime Verification for Timed Asynchronous Networks
by: Luis Miguel Danielsson, et al.
Published: (2023-01-01) -
A DSL-based runtime adaptivity framework for Java
by: Tiago Carvalho, et al.
Published: (2023-07-01)